内存管理技巧:如何查看和解决操作系统内存使用问题

时间:2025-12-15 分类:操作系统

当今计算机操作系统的性能与内存管理息息相关。随着应用程序的不断增多,如何合理查看和解决内存使用问题已成为用户不可避免的挑战。良好的内存管理不仅能提高系统的响应速度,还能延长硬件的使用寿命。无论是个人用户还是企业IT管理者,都需要掌握一些有效的内存管理技巧,以确保系统能够高效运转。本文将深入探讨如何监测内存使用情况,并提供对应的解决方案,以帮助用户更好地管理和优化系统的内存资源。

内存管理技巧:如何查看和解决操作系统内存使用问题

要查看内存使用情况,需要借助操作系统自带的工具或第三方软件。在Windows系统中,可以使用任务管理器查看每个进程的内存占用情况。通过按下Ctrl + Shift + Esc组合键,即可快速打开任务管理器。在性能标签页下,可以清晰地看到内存的总量、已使用量和可用量。通过详细信息选项,可以进一步深入了解每个进程对应的内存使用情况,方便用户针对性地进行优化。

接下来,Linux用户可以通过命令行工具获取内存使用情况。使用`free -m`命令,能够快速查看系统的内存状态,包括总内存、已使用内存和空闲内存。`top`命令也提供了实时监控功能,用户可以观察到每个运行进程的内存占用情况。借助这些命令,用户可以及时发现异常进程并做出相应处理。

解决内存使用问题的前提是发现问题后及时采取措施。在Windows系统中,对于占用内存过多的程序,用户可以选择结束进程,或是重启该应用程序。可以通过启动选项卡管理启动项,禁用一些不必要的开机程序,以减少内存占用。在Linux环境下,使用`kill`命令结束占用内存过高的进程,也是常见的解决方式。

优化内存使用的策略还包括定期清理系统中的临时文件和缓存。对于Windows用户,可以使用磁盘清理工具进行定期清理,减少不必要的存储占用。Linux用户则可以利用`apt-get clean`等命令来清理不再需要的软件包,以释放内存空间。

在进行以上操作之前,定期备份重要数据是非常必要的,尤其是在处理系统文件时。通过定期备份,可以避免因为误操作导致数据丢失,从而在一定程度上保护系统的稳定性和安全性。考虑到长期内存管理,可以购买额外的内存条,升级硬件配置,以支持更多的应用程序和服务。

内存管理是操作系统性能优化的关键环节。用户通过合理监测和及时解决内存问题,能够有效提升系统的运行效率。在不断发展的技术环境中,掌握内存使用技巧显得尤为重要。希望本文的分享能够帮助用户在日常使用中,更加轻松地应对内存管理问题,享受更流畅的计算体验。